Save your Prestige Tokens: The best strategy for Black Ops 6 Season 1

With Call of Duty launching on Thursday, players are encouraged to reconsider using Prestige Tokens when buying Black Ops 6 Season 1 Battle Pass. Learning to save your tokens correctly and at the right time is crucial to gameplay and experience.

Prestige Tokens rewards are only earned after players level up in the game, and these tokens are used primarily to purchase weapons and gear after players decide to reset their levels. 

In the past, players only used these tokens to buy particular items of their choice after getting into Prestige mode. That said, with the new structure of Battle Pass, this approach may be less efficient than it used to be.

 New weapons without the tokens

Season 1 introduces a host of new weapon blueprints, such as the Tanto.22 Submachine Gun, SVD Sniper Rifle. These weapons are included in the Battle Pass; you do not require Prestige Tokens to get them. This makes it a more efficient way of improving your arsenal without using tokens for items that are relatively easy to obtain anyway.

Smart use of prestige tokens

As with the new weapons, if a player receives these items as part of the Battle Pass, waiting for a specific Prestige Token may be more beneficial to purchase items unavailable through the Battle Pass. Doing so guarantees you are optimising your resources and unleashing hard-worded weapons that are not included in the season’s reward.

Why save your tokens?

You save your tokens for non-Battle Pass items while progressing through tiers offering special or uncommon skins and equipment. This extends the elegance of using the maximum number of tokens to unlock content, which is a shame to spend on content you can unlock just by playing the game through the Battle Pass.

In Black Ops 6 and beyond, paying attention to how you handle your Prestige Tokens will significantly impact your gaming experience. 

Tokens should not be spent on buying items for which you can get a Battle Pass, as those are better spent on skins that cannot be unlocked with a pass. Doing so ensures players get the highest value for tokens.
